|
![探花[1926经验]](http://icon.zol.com.cn/bbs/detail/time_yueliang.gif) ![探花[1926经验]](http://icon.zol.com.cn/bbs/detail/time_star.gif)
- 帖子
- 481 查看所有帖>>
- 精华
- 1
- Z话费
- 115
- Z 币
- 5
- 性别
- 男
- 注册时间
- 2008-06-06 08:47:58
|
主楼#
大
中
小
发表于 2008-07-02 14:28:44
不刷机也玩JAVA多开和更改字体
首先要真心谢谢大侠们的辛勤劳动,给咱们大家使用E6带来无限乐趣!!!
因为"站在了巨人的肩膀上",所以很多事情变得简单了.
我手机是网上买的港货,版本R533_G_11.12.06P.因为怕刷了机不稳定,当前系统挺稳定的,所以始终忍着没刷机.
####################################
好,接下来讲如何实现JAVA多开.
1.首先请,下载附件java.rar.
Java.rar(大小173k)
这个贴子应该是介绍刷过机的多开方法.我们利用附件里的am_java文件.
2.请下载<笔画输入法正式版>,这么好的东西相信大家一定都用了吧.(再次谢谢大侠们了)下载StrokeIME_Bind.rar.
StrokeIME_bind.rar(大小4k)
3.java.rar解压后,把am_java拷到SD卡根目录或任意目录(以下是以根目录为例)
4.安装好StrokeIME_Bind.
5.接下来找到StrokeIME_Bind的安装目录,在SD卡的.system\QTDownLoad\StrokeIME1\.可以用优盘模式来查看修改,也可以用大侠们提供的工具(文件管理,我的记事,如果你已装过的话)直接来在手机里查看修改.
我们看目录下有两个lin文件,StrokelME.lin和run.lin.
安装好StrokeIME_Bind后,在菜单程序中的"笔画输入法"是调用执行StrokelME.lin.我们查看StrokelME.lin,看到它是再调用run.lin的.我们只需修改run.lin
6.查看run.lin
先看里面的内容.
#!/bin/bash
# Written for E6 and A1200, foxe6, 2008/03/19
mount --bind /ezxlocal/.system/QTDownLoad/StrokeIME/libStrokeIME.so /usr/language/inputmethods/libzhuyinboard.so
第一行以#!开头,描述是什么shell执行,我们不用关心
第二行以#开头,是注释,我们不用关心
第三行的执行结果的可以理解为用libStrokeIME.so代替libzhuyinboard.so
7.修改run.lin
接下来我们修改run.lin
1)如果没有安装笔画输入法,可以把第三行删掉
2)增加两行
mount --bind /mmc/mmca1/am_java /usr/SYSqtapp/am/am
/sbin/start-stop-daemon -K -n am
(注:这一行相当于平时装完PKG后的刷新屏幕)
(另注:Linux系统字母大小写敏感的)
8.保存后重启E6.以后每次重启后首先到菜单程序中执行"笔画输入法"
好了,JAVA程序就可以多开了.
注:各java程序切换时有点切不准确,不过配合挂断键多切几次就能切到位了.
####################################
接下来讲如何实现自定义字体.
1.在windows里的fonts目录中找到自己喜欢的中文字体文件,把它(们)拷到手机里,我是拷到了SD卡下的MyFonts目录下.把想使用的字体文件复制一份,改名为myfont.ttf
注:有些字体文件不支持繁体字或GBK大字符集,请注意选择.可以先在word或wps里试一下.
2.修改上面讲到的run.lin文件
mount --bind /mmc/mmca1/MyFonts/myfont.ttf /usr/language/fonts/AMCSL.TTF
/sbin/start-stop-daemon -K -n am
好了重启后,执行"笔画输入法"就OK了
####################################
以下晒一下我目前run.lin内容:
#!/bin/bash
# begin
# Written for E6 and A1200, foxe6, 2008/03/19
mount --bind /ezxlocal/.system/QTDownLoad/StrokeIME/libStrokeIME.so
/usr/language/inputmethods/libpinyinboard.so
mount --bind /mmc/mmca1/MyFonts/myfont.ttf /usr/language/fonts/AMCSL.TTF
mount --bind /mmc/mmca1/am_java /usr/SYSqtapp/am/am
/sbin/start-stop-daemon -K -n am
sleep 30
. /home/native/.profile
start-stop-daemon -S -c root -x /mmc/mmca1/.system/QTDownLoad/memext1/memext.lin
start-stop-daemon -S -c root -x /mmc/mmca1/.system/QTDownLoad/screenlock/sl.lin
start-stop-daemon -S -c root -x /mmc/mmca1/.system/QTDownLoad/yan0_miss/yan0_miss.lin
# end
后面几行是把扩展内存,屏锁程序,yan0助手也一并执行了.
#################################################
以上内容是主要根据大侠和机友们的大量的辛苦劳动而来,自己再进行了一些吸纳和理解.没刷机的朋友们可以试一下.如果也成功的,请顶一下,让其他没刷机的朋友也能玩java多开和更改字体.
谢谢
|